Narrative Description:
A handmade book printed letterpress on Shadowmould paper from all handset Centaur, Arrighi and Mistral types. With 21 letterpressed illustrations, 9 of which are large tipped-in plates.
Edition is limited to 60 copies, numbered and signed by Carol Cunningham and Gene Holtan, an award-winning book illustrator. Bound at Taurus Bookbindery by John Demerritt, in textured white cloth with green satin spine, putti illustration in black impressed on front cover, and title impressed in black on spine.
A whimsical book about the nine Greek Muses, patronesses of the arts, enlivened by Gene’s drawings of muses and putti. The final page has a little drawing (not in the miniature edition) that Gene did of himself on a letter to Carol, which she subsequently included in the book. This is the large format edition that preceded the miniature version of this title printed by Sunflower Press in 1998. Entertaining and informative too—Greek mythology has never been this fun!
